Abstract

In this paper, a method for vehicle driver’s intention recognition is investigated through an optimized hidden Markov model (HMM). As uncertainties exist between modeling and application of intention recognition with HMM, the Baum-Welch (B-W) algorithm is introduced to optimize and update the parameters of the established HMM. The major steps within the optimization process, such as acquisitions of forward probabilities, backward probabilities, maximum expected probabilities ratio, elements updates of matrixes π, A and B, and setups of recursion terminated condition, are fully described in the paper. An elaborate example presented at the end of the paper shows the credibility and effectiveness of the proposed algorithm.
